Hawkins Way Capital Expands Its Portfolio in New York City

Hawkins Way Capital, a prominent real estate investment firm, has announced an exciting new chapter in its expansion strategy. The company has successfully acquired a former 492-key Holiday Inn, which is well situated in New York City. This strategic move not only strengthens Hawkins Way's presence in the urban landscape but also highlights their commitment to repositioning valuable assets within their portfolio.

Strategic Repositioning of the Acquired Property

Once a bustling Holiday Inn, this property, located in the heart of Manhattan's Financial District, will undergo significant redevelopment efforts. The firm is intent on transforming an out-of-favor asset into a vibrant space that meets the contemporary needs of urban dwellers. Hawkins Way Capital emphasizes the importance of identifying opportunities that arise from changing market conditions, particularly those influenced by the COVID-19 pandemic.

Value-Added Opportunities Within the Market

The real estate landscape continues to evolve, and Hawkins Way is leveraging this evolution to enhance its investment portfolio. The company's innovative approach to value-added investments aims to create spaces that resonate with modern demand. The former Holiday Inn, which halted its standard operations during the pandemic, will be revitalized into accommodations that offer more than just a place to stay. Plans include renovations that will create inviting guest rooms, functional communal spaces, and amenities designed for both relaxation and productivity.

Targeted Renovations to Improve Guest Experience

The redevelopment strategy includes a comprehensive renovation plan focused on both aesthetic and functional upgrades. Hawkins Way plans to renovate all guest rooms and hallways while incorporating shared amenities that blend comfort with convenience. Guests will benefit from communal kitchens, dining areas, laundry facilities, lounges, study spaces, and an on-site fitness center. These enhancements are intended to foster a sense of community among guests, offering a unique and enriching living experience.

The Role of FCL Management

In managing the repositioned property, Hawkins Way has partnered with FCL Management, a recognized leader in operating hotel and housing assets across the United States. FCL Management, which oversees around 6,000 beds in its portfolio, brings valuable expertise that is vital for the successful management and operation of the newly acquired asset.
